How to Prepare for MRI Tech Schools

MRI Certification Programs

Do you have your heart set on becoming an MRI technologist? If yes, it’s time to prepare before joining one of the available MRI tech schools. Becoming an MRI tech isn’t an easy feat. You’ll be responsible for dozens of patients every week.

Your role will be to capture valuable diagnostic images to assist physicians in patient care. MRI techs have plenty of contact with patients as they ask them questions, prep them for the procedure, and explain it to them. While this might seem overwhelming, rest assured that MRI tech schools exist to help prepare you for the job. It’s up to you to do your best and prepare yourself for the beginning of your career.

Choose Your Classes and Excel

Many high school students are interested in pursuing a career in MRI radiology after graduating. If you’re one of them, you need to choose classes that are relevant to radiology. These include biology, physics, and math. Getting high grades in these subjects will help you get into the school that you want.

Another way of becoming an MRI technologist is by specializing after becoming a radiology tech. Switching to MRIs won’t be too difficult if you’re a radiology tech working with ultrasounds or x-rays. You’ll still need to join an MRI program for a few months before taking the ARRT test and becoming certified.

Find Certified MRI Tech Schools

All MRI technologists have one thing in common: certification. Certification and licensure are mostly conducted by the ARRT. As long as you’re registered with it, you’ll be able to work as an MRI technician or technologist. The way to become a registered ARRT technologist is by bypassing the ARRT certification exam.

You can’t just sign up for the exam and take it. The ARRT has certain requirements that need to be fulfilled before you can take the test. One of these is to have completed a certified MRI tech program. You need to check different schools and programs and make sure they’re ARRT approved before joining one of them.

Extracurricular Activities

There are many ways to boost your application when applying to any school and MRI tech schools are no different. Extracurricular activities like participating in charity events and helping your community are valuable. You can also try and shadow a licensed MRI tech and see what the job is like. This can help demonstrate your interest in the field.

First aid courses are important. As an MRI tech, you’ll be working in a medical setting. All healthcare team members need to know first aid to rapidly assist patients needing help.
